Finance and Stock Market Concepts for Investor Preparation

Finance and stock market education provides an important foundation for individuals who want to develop a better understanding of investing and business performance.

Preparing as an investor involves learning key financial concepts, understanding how markets operate, and developing the ability to evaluate information carefully.

A strong educational background helps individuals approach financial topics with greater confidence and awareness.

One of the first concepts in investor preparation is understanding how companies create value. Businesses generate revenue through their products and services, manage expenses, and make decisions that influence their future growth. Learning how these activities affect company performance helps investors understand why financial information is an important part of market analysis.

Stock market concepts introduce the relationship between companies and investors. The stock market allows individuals to participate in the growth of businesses by owning shares. However, understanding market activities requires more than simply observing price changes. Investors benefit from learning about company fundamentals, industry conditions, and economic factors that can influence business performance.

Financial statements are essential tools for investor education. Documents such as income statements, balance sheets, and cash flow reports provide insights into a company’s financial condition. By learning how to read these reports, individuals can better understand important areas such as profitability, financial stability, and business operations.

Another important part of preparation is learning about risk and uncertainty. Markets can change due to many factors, including economic developments, consumer behaviour, and industry trends. Understanding that investments involve different levels of risk encourages individuals to focus on research, planning, and responsible decision-making.

Diversification is also a valuable concept for new investors to understand. Building awareness of different types of assets and market sectors can help explain how investors manage exposure to changing conditions. Learning about diversification supports a more balanced approach to financial planning.

Market research skills are equally important for investor development. Studying industries, comparing companies, and reviewing financial information helps individuals create a clearer picture of potential opportunities. Good research habits encourage thoughtful analysis rather than relying on short-term opinions or incomplete information.

Continuous learning plays a major role in becoming a knowledgeable investor. Financial markets continue to evolve because of technology, innovation, and global economic changes. Investors who continue expanding their knowledge are better prepared to understand new developments and adjust their thinking over time.

Finance and stock market concepts for investor preparation help build valuable skills for understanding modern financial environments. By learning about company performance, market behaviour, financial reports, and risk awareness, individuals can develop stronger financial knowledge. Education and careful research provide a foundation for making informed decisions and creating a responsible approach to exploring investment topics.
